The Marine Corps birthday is November 10, 1775. Marines across the globe celebrate this day every year in a variety of different ways.  Sometimes they’re in a fighting hole in a far-off distant land eating an MRE (meal ready to eat), sometimes at a local gathering with a few other Marines, but most often in a nice venue such as the Aviator Resort ball room here in St Louis.

Working alongside the St Louis Marine Corps League our cadets provided the color guard and then fashioned vintage Marine uniforms during the pageant.
